Routine Examination and Upkeep


Among the most important aspects of plumbing maintenance is conducting regular inspections. Look for leakages, trickles, and indications of deterioration in pipes, fixtures, and home appliances. Resolving minor issues early can assist stop even more substantial issues down the line.

 

Maintaining Drainpipes and Sewage Systems


Blocked drains and sewage system lines can cause backups and pricey repair services. To prevent this, stay clear of flushing non-biodegradable things down the toilet and use drainpipe displays to capture hair and debris. On a regular basis flush drains with hot water and baking soft drink to maintain them clear.

 

Protecting Pipelines from Cold


In cooler climates, icy pipelines can be a substantial issue throughout the cold weather. To stop pipelines from cold and bursting, protect revealed pipelines, separate exterior hoses, and keep faucets leaking during freezing temperature levels.

 

Hot Water Heater Upkeep


Hot water heater must be purged consistently to get rid of debris accumulation and preserve effectiveness. Check the temperature and stress relief valve for leaks and ensure correct ventilation around the unit.

 

Protecting Against Pipes Emergencies


While some plumbing emergency situations are unavoidable, numerous can be stopped with appropriate maintenance. Know where your main water shut-off valve is located and just how to utilize it in case of an emergency situation. Take into consideration setting up water leak detection tools for included security.

 

Addressing Minor Issues Without Delay


Don't ignore small pipes issues like dripping taps or running bathrooms. Also small leaks can lose significant amounts of water over time and result in expensive water damages. Addressing these issues promptly can save you money in the long run.

 

Water Quality Testing


Regularly evaluate your water top quality to guarantee it fulfills safety and security criteria. Think about setting up a water filtration system if your water contains contaminations or has an undesirable taste or smell.

 

Garbage Disposal Upkeep


To keep your garbage disposal running smoothly, avoid putting fibrous or starchy foods, grease, or non-food items down the drain. Periodically grind ice cubes and citrus peels to tidy and deodorise the disposal.

 

Sump Pump Upkeep


If your home has a sump pump, ensure it is operating appropriately, especially throughout heavy rainfall. Evaluate the pump routinely and keep the pit without particles to prevent obstructions.

 

Inspecting Water Pressure


High water stress can harm pipelines and components, while reduced stress can show underlying pipes concerns. Make use of a pressure scale to keep track of water pressure and change it as required.

 

Keeping Exterior Pipes


During the warmer months, examine outside faucets, hoses, and automatic sprinkler for leaks or damages. Turn off outside water sources prior to the very first freeze to prevent ruptured pipes.

 

Enlightening Family Members


Get every person in your home associated with plumbing upkeep. Teach member of the family how to identify leakages, shut off the water system, and use plumbing fixtures properly.

 

Specialist Pipes Evaluations


In addition to DIY maintenance tasks, routine regular examinations with a qualified plumber. An expert can identify prospective issues early and suggest safety nets to keep your pipes system in leading condition.

Recognizing the Importance of Plumbing Maintenance


Plumbing maintenance goes beyond just fixing problems as they occur; it’s about stopping issues before they turn into costly and disruptive challenges. Regular checks and upkeep can bring various advantages;


Financial Benefits: One of the key reasons to prioritize preventive plumbing maintenance is the opportunity for substantial cost savings. Detecting and addressing minor issues early on can prevent them from escalating into major, expensive complications. For instance, repairing a small pipe leak is much more affordable than dealing with extensive water damage from a burst pipe.


Prolonged Durability: Your plumbing system, which includes pipes, fixtures and appliances, is built to last for many years.


Ensuring proper upkeep can help extend the lifespan of your plumbing system, allowing you to maximize your investments.


Enhanced Efficiency: A well maintained plumbing setup operates more effectively, resulting in reduced water and energy usage by your fixtures and appliances. This not only cuts down on utility costs but also lessens the environmental impact.


Peace of Mind: Having confidence in the good condition of your plumbing system brings peace of mind. You can rest assured knowing that unexpected leaks, clogs or other plumbing issues are less likely to occur.

 

Understanding Routine Plumbing Maintenance

 
  • Adopting a Proactive Approach


  •  
  • Now that you recognize the importance of maintaining your plumbing system, let’s explore what this entails;


  •  
  • Regular Inspections: Arrange for annual or bi annual check ups by a certified plumber to catch potential problems early and receive advice on necessary repairs or replacements.


  •  
  • Leak Detection: Even small leaks can lead to significant damage over time. Plumbers use specialized tools to locate hidden leaks within walls, floors or ceilings.


  •  
  • Clearing Drains: Blockages can impede drain flow and cause backups. Regular drain cleaning helps prevent obstructions and ensures smooth water drainage.


  •  
  • Water Heater Maintenance: Improving the efficiency and prolonging the lifespan of your water heater can be achieved by conducting regular flushing and inspecting its various components.


  •  
  • Checking Fixtures and Appliances: Plumbers have the expertise to examine faucets, toilets, washing machines and other household fixtures for potential leaks, wear and tear or damage.


  •  
  • Testing Sump Pumps: It is crucial to ensure that your sump pump is functioning properly to prevent basement flooding risks.


  •  

Maintaining Your Plumbing System Between Professional Check Ups

 
  • While professional plumbing inspections are important, there are proactive measures you can implement to keep your plumbing system in good shape;


  •  
  • Regular Drain Cleaning: Utilize drain screens to prevent debris from entering pipes and regularly clear sink and shower drains to avoid blockages.


  •  
  • Leak Detection: Stay vigilant for any indications of leaks such as water stains on walls or ceilings, musty smells or damp areas.


  •  
  • Monitoring Water Pressure: Fluctuations in water pressure may signal underlying plumbing issues. Contact a plumber if you notice significant changes in pressure levels.


  •  
  • Avoiding Chemical Drain Cleaners: Opt for non chemical methods like plungers or drain snakes when dealing with clogs as chemical cleaners can potentially harm pipes. Make sure you are aware of the whereabouts of the shut off valves; It’s crucial to know where your main water shut off valve is situated and how to operate it.
